What is Motor Oil?

Motor oil, also known as engine oil, is a lubricant designed to reduce friction between moving parts in your engine. It is typically made from a combination of base oils and additives. Base oils provide lubrication and viscosity, while additives enhance the oil’s performance, such as detergents, dispersants, and anti-wear agents.

There are various types of motor oil, including:

  • Conventional oil: Suitable for most passenger vehicles, it provides good lubrication and protection.
  • Synthetic oil: Offers superior lubrication and protection in extreme temperatures, ideal for high-performance vehicles or those driven in harsh conditions.
  • Synthetic blend oil: A mix of conventional and synthetic oil, providing a balance between price and performance.
  • Full synthetic oil: The highest quality oil, offering exceptional lubrication and protection in extreme temperatures.
  • High mileage oil: Designed for vehicles with high mileage, it contains additives to condition seals and gaskets.

What Does Bad Motor Oil Look Like?

Bad motor oil can appear in various forms, including:

Dark or Black Color

Bad motor oil often has a dark or black color, which indicates it has broken down and is no longer effective. This can be due to:

  • High mileage: Oil can become dark and dirty over time, even if it’s been changed regularly.
  • Contamination: Oil can become contaminated with dirt, dust, or debris, causing it to darken.
  • Breakdown: Oil can break down due to heat, pressure, or chemical reactions, leading to a dark color.

Table 1: Comparison of good and bad motor oil colors

ColorDescription
Light brown or amberGood motor oil, clean and free of contaminants
Dark brown or blackBad motor oil, broken down or contaminated

Thick or Viscous Consistency

Bad motor oil can become thick or viscous, making it difficult to flow through the engine. This can be due to:

  • High mileage: Oil can thicken over time, reducing its ability to flow.
  • Contamination: Oil can become contaminated with debris or dirt, causing it to thicken.
  • Breakdown: Oil can break down due to heat, pressure, or chemical reactions, leading to a thick consistency.

Sludge or Debris

Bad motor oil can contain sludge or debris, which can clog engine passages and cause damage. This can be due to: (See Also: How Much Oil Does a 1.4 Engine Need? Essential Guide)

  • Contamination: Oil can become contaminated with dirt, dust, or debris.
  • Breakdown: Oil can break down due to heat, pressure, or chemical reactions, leading to sludge formation.

Unpleasant Odor

Bad motor oil can have an unpleasant odor, which can indicate:

  • Contamination: Oil can become contaminated with debris or dirt, causing an unpleasant smell.
  • Breakdown: Oil can break down due to heat, pressure, or chemical reactions, leading to a foul odor.

Effects of Bad Motor Oil on Your Engine

Using bad motor oil can lead to catastrophic consequences, including:

Engine Failure

Bad motor oil can cause engine failure by:

  • Lubrication failure: Oil can break down, leading to increased friction and wear on engine components.
  • Corrosion: Oil can become acidic, causing corrosion on engine components.
  • Overheating: Oil can break down, leading to increased engine temperatures.

Increased Emissions

Bad motor oil can increase emissions by:

  • Reduced fuel efficiency: Oil can break down, leading to decreased fuel efficiency.
  • Increased combustion: Oil can become acidic, causing increased combustion and emissions.

Decreased Fuel Efficiency

Bad motor oil can decrease fuel efficiency by:

  • Increased friction: Oil can break down, leading to increased friction and wear on engine components.
  • Reduced engine performance: Oil can become contaminated or break down, leading to reduced engine performance.

FAQs

What is the best type of motor oil for my vehicle?

The best type of motor oil for your vehicle depends on your vehicle’s make, model, and year. Check your owner’s manual or consult with a mechanic to determine the best type of oil for your vehicle.

How often should I change my motor oil?

The frequency of oil changes depends on your vehicle’s make, model, and year, as well as your driving habits. Check your owner’s manual or consult with a mechanic to determine the best oil change interval for your vehicle. (See Also: Can No Oil Make Your Car Not Start? The Shocking Truth)

Can I use synthetic oil in my conventional engine?

Yes, you can use synthetic oil in your conventional engine, but it’s essential to check your owner’s manual or consult with a mechanic to ensure compatibility.

What are the signs of bad motor oil?

The signs of bad motor oil include dark or black color, thick or viscous consistency, sludge or debris, and unpleasant odor.

Can I fix bad motor oil by adding additives?

No, adding additives to bad motor oil will not fix the issue. It’s essential to change the oil and use the correct type of oil to prevent further damage to your engine.
